What is Datadog?

Datadog is a software that offers monitoring and analytics capabilities for cloud-scale applications. The software collects metrics, traces, logs, and events from various sources and provides dashboards, alerts, and visualization tools to help users track the performance and health of systems and services. Datadog integrates with cloud infrastructure, containers, databases, and applications, enabling users to correlate data across their technology stack. The software addresses challenges related to dynamic, distributed environments by providing observability and insights that support incident detection, troubleshooting, and optimization of resources and applications. It is designed to facilitate collaboration between development, operations, and security teams in managing application reliability and system performance.

Datadog Pricing

Datadog software uses a subscription-based pricing model structured by product type with options for pay-as-you-go and tiered plans based on usage volume such as number of hosts, logs, traces, or specific monitoring features, allowing users to select plans that fit different monitoring and analytics requirements.

About Company

Company Description

Updated 25th July 2024

Datadog specializes in providing a comprehensive monitoring platform for cloud applications. It collects data from diverse sources such as servers, containers, databases, and third-party services, aiming to make the stack fully observable. By offering these features, Datadog assists DevOps teams in preventing downtime, addressing performance problems, and ensuring optimal user experience.
